Commit: ff46d7b3e0870a70331b069372c36fbc43018c2d Parent: 2fb42b11f61cbcef7dfc225c1d26c4511436583d Author: Adrian Hunter <ext-adrian.hunter@nokia.com> AuthorDate: Mon Jul 21 15:39:05 2008 +0300 Committer: Artem Bityutskiy <Artem.Bityutskiy@nokia.com> CommitDate: Wed Aug 13 11:24:26 2008 +0300 UBIFS: make ubifs_ro_mode() not inline We use ubifs_ro_mode() quite a lot, and not in fast-path, so there is no reason to blow the code up by having it inlined. Also, we usually want R/O mode change to be seen to other CPUs as soon as possible, so when we make this a function call, we will automatically have a memory barrier.
